Prudential (NYSE:PUK) Upgraded to Hold at StockNews.com

Prudential (NYSE:PUKGet Free Report) was upgraded by investment analysts at StockNews.com from a “sell” rating to a “hold” rating in a report issued on Wednesday.

Separately, BNP Paribas upgraded Prudential from a “neutral” rating to an “outperform” rating in a research report on Wednesday, June 26th.

Prudential Stock Down 0.1 %

Shares of PUK stock opened at $18.21 on Wednesday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.22, a current ratio of 0.03 and a quick ratio of 0.03. Prudential has a one year low of $17.12 and a one year high of $28.59. The company’s fifty day moving average price is $19.07 and its 200-day moving average price is $19.94. The company has a market capitalization of $25.04 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 8.51, a PEG ratio of 0.41 and a beta of 1.28.

Prudential Company Profile

Prudential plc, through its subsidiaries, provides life and health insurance, and asset management solutions to individuals in Asia and Africa. The company was founded in 1848 and is headquartered in Central, Hong Kong.
